How We Chose Our Champs
As a team, we road-tested hundreds (and hundreds…and hundreds…) of products over the past year to help determine which standouts are truly exceptional for 2023. All of the gear, equipment, and activewear you’re about to go googly-eyed over have been tried and vetted by our editors and/or WH advisors we know and trust, who train with them firsthand or with clients. If a product still piqued our interest but we couldn’t test it for supply or logistical reasons, it had to be highly rated based on detailed and extensive customer reviews on multiple trusted retailers.
